Analysis of a dream series by the Dream Coding System developed by Ulrich Moser

Research in psychotherapy August 12, 2021 G. Pap, Fritz Lackinger, G. Kamp et al.

A theory-based content analysis of dreams reported during psychodynamic psychotherapy, using the Moser and Hortig dream coding method, reveals changes in the patient's inner psychic process. The manifest dream content, analyzed as a series, showed an initial dominance of the safety principle, followed by increased involvement, more flexible use of dream elements, and more mixed interactions, before returning to themes similar to the initial dream. The coding indicates that the patient improved her ability to regulate affect and increased self-efficacy through better containment of dysfunctional affects. This approach provides an empirical method for assessing therapeutic change in single case studies.
